    Abstract: A cutter head for a mining machine includes a drum defining a drum axis with a drum plane extending perpendicular to the drum axis. The cutter head includes a plurality of cutting bit assemblies secured to an outer surface of the drum proximate a first end. Each cutting bit assembly includes a block and a bit. The bit includes a tip configured to engage a mine surface. The bit defines a bit axis, and the bit axis defines a first lean angle relative to the drum plane. The plurality of cutting bit assemblies includes a first series having four first bits, a second series having two second bits, a third series having two third bits, and a fourth series having two fourth bits. Each of the first bits includes a first tip and defines a first bit axis oriented at a first lean angle relative to the drum plane. The first lean angle is between about 60 degrees and about 75 degrees.

    Abstract: A longwall shearer mining machine that is mounted on a rail generally includes a first chassis portion with a first cutting arm mounted thereto and a second chassis portion with a second cutting arm mounted thereto. Each of the first and the second chassis portions is slidably coupled to the rail. The first and second chassis portions are coupled at a pivot joint. The pivot joint allows each of the first and the second chassis portions to adjust its respective orientation with respect to a horizontal ground plane when the articulated shearer travels over a hump or a valley, thereby maintaining sufficient headroom.

    Abstract: A mining machine is employed in a mechanized method for removing mineral from a reef in a rock face. The mining machine comprises a first cutting disc rotatably mounted on one side, a second cutting disc rotatably mounted on the machine, at a position off-set from the first disc and a cutting drum The first disc is adapted to remove a portion of the rock face as the machine is traversed along the face; and said drum is mounted upon an arm which is vertically repositionable to allow the cutting drum to remove rock from the roof and floor of the trench formed by the action of the cutting discs.

    Abstract: An apparatus for cutting and breaking rock includes a cutting disc (13) having an attached wedge (11). Cutting disc (13) can be rotated by shaft (16) to cut a groove into rock. After a pre-determined distance, wedge (11) is forced into the cut groove to cause the rock above the groove to be broken away. Shaft (16) is powered by a drive motor, and can include a kick back mechanism to prevent wedge (11) from being trapped in the cut groove. The entire apparatus can be mounted to the three point linkage of a tractor.

    Abstract: A mining machine 1 of the shearer type comprises an elongate machine body 2 housing inter alia a power unit 11 for powering at least one rotary, mineral cutting head 10, and at least one haulage unit 12 mounted on the outside of the machine body. The haulage unit includes a variable speed motor 16, such as an electric AC motor. The motor is connected via speed reduction gearing 19 to a machine haulage sprocket 13 adapted to progressively engage rack bars 14 or a chain extending along the mineral face 5. A brake unit is also provided in the haulage unit. By locating one or more haulage units outside the machine body, the units can be located at appropriate locations, on either the goaf or face sides of the machine, or both sides, to suit particular operating conditions.

    Abstract: A mineral winning machine is moved back and forth along a mineral, e.g., coal, face to win mineral by a combination of cutting and wedging actions. To effect this winning mode, the machine has at least one cutting device with a cutting disk rotating in front of a frusto-conical wedging body which revolves in an eccentric manner to detach the mineral previously backcut by the disk. The wedging body and the cutting disk are driven by separate concentric drive shafts, preferably with variable speed regulation with the disk rotating faster than the wedging body. In an alternative construction, a cutting chain equipped with both cutting and wedging tools in differential relationship is circulated and engages the mineral face.

    Abstract: A longwall mining machine incorporates breaking apparatus comprising an underframe which may be an integral extension of the main underframe of the machine and which is mounted on the conveyor for movement therealong, such that the breaking apparatus is rigidly secured to, and comprises an integral part of, the mining machine. The breaking apparatus also comprises a rotary breaking element drivably carried by the breaker underframe and a reaction plate, for example, on the same underframe, which is spaced from an adjacent periphery of the breaking element. In use, material, such as coal and rocks, on the conveyor passing between the rotary element and the reaction plate is broken against the reaction plate by the rotating breaking element. In this way, the coal and rocks are broken down to a sufficiently small size that they will not become jammed under the main underframe of the mining machine.
